Our Stylist Says

I love the Atelje Lyktan Pluggie’s sleek, modern design combined with its soft, diffused glow, making it a versatile addition to both contemporary and minimal interiors. The black opal glass shade adds a touch of understated sophistication and works well in monochrome schemes or with wood and metal accents. It’s particularly suitable for bedside tables, workspaces, or sideboards, where its compact size and easy plug-in design make it practical and unobtrusive. For styling, consider pairing it with other clean-lined objects or adding a textured fabric to soften the overall look-its gentle light helps create cosy atmospheres, making it a functional yet stylish accent.

An Odyssey in Scandinavian Design

Established in 2002, Nordic Nest underwent a transformation in name from Scandinavian Design Center in 2019. However, its core ethos remained unchanged - to introduce the world to the elegance and simplicity of Scandinavian interior design.

Today, it's not just a brand; it's a hallmark of premium Nordic design, offering a selection of over 30,000 products. From classic iconic pieces to contemporary marvels, the company provides a design experience that captures the very essence of a Scandinavian home - personal, timeless, and filled with memories.

Bridging Cultures Through Translation

In today's interconnected world, language shouldn't stand in the way. To ensure their customers around the world can easily browse and shop, Nordic Nest partnered with Contentor, a company specialising in translations, to offer their website in multiple languages.

Their online shop, now available in ten languages, shows their commitment to localised content, ensuring that every visitor feels a personal connection.

Working with Contentor, Nordic Nest has focused on more than just translating words. They've worked together to create a full, enjoyable shopping experience for customers everywhere.
